Built In Cabinetry Staining in Dayton, OH

Built-in cabinetry staining services involve applying a durable stain to enhance the appearance of existing built-in furniture and storage solutions. This process is commonly used on kitchen cabinets, bookshelves, entertainment centers, and closet systems to refresh or change their look without replacing the entire unit. Property owners often request staining to highlight wood grain, match new finishes with existing decor, or achieve a specific color tone that complements their interior design. Before requesting this service, it’s helpful to understand the current condition of the cabinetry, including any existing finishes, and to consider the desired color or stain type to ensure the final result aligns with personal preferences.

Homeowners typically want to know about the scope of staining projects, including whether the existing surface needs preparation such as cleaning, sanding, or repairing. It’s also common to inquire about the types of stains available, their durability, and the expected maintenance requirements. Proper surface preparation and selecting the right stain are essential for achieving a smooth, even finish that enhances the natural beauty of the wood. Clear communication about the project’s goals and the current state of the cabinetry helps ensure the staining process meets expectations and results in an attractive, long-lasting appearance.

FAQ

Built In Cabinetry Staining Questions

What types of cabinetry can be stained? Built-in cabinetry made of wood or similar materials can be stained to enhance appearance and protect the surface.

How does staining improve the look of built-in cabinets? Staining highlights the wood grain, adds depth of color, and can complement existing decor styles.

Is staining suitable for all finishes on built-in cabinetry? Staining works best on bare or lightly finished wood surfaces; existing paint or heavy finishes may require different treatments.

What should property owners consider before staining built-in cabinetry? Proper surface preparation and choosing the right stain color are key to achieving a desired look and long-lasting results.
